在ng-click中自动发送邮件可以通过以下步骤实现:
以下是一个示例代码:
在HTML模板中:
<button ng-click="sendEmail()">发送邮件</button>
在AngularJS控制器中:
app.controller('EmailController', function($scope, $http) {
$scope.sendEmail = function() {
$http.post('/send-email', { recipient: 'example@example.com', subject: '邮件主题', body: '邮件内容' })
.then(function(response) {
console.log('邮件发送成功');
})
.catch(function(error) {
console.error('邮件发送失败', error);
});
};
});
在后端服务中(示例使用Node.js和Express框架):
app.post('/send-email', function(req, res) {
const recipient = req.body.recipient;
const subject = req.body.subject;
const body = req.body.body;
// 使用邮件发送库或API发送邮件
// ...
res.sendStatus(200);
});
请注意,上述代码仅为示例,实际实现中需要根据你的具体需求和后端技术栈进行适当的调整。
关于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体的云计算品牌商,建议你参考腾讯云的官方文档和产品介绍页面,以了解他们提供的邮件发送服务和相关产品。
<!DOCTYPE html>
<html ng-app="myApp">
<head>
<meta charset="utf-8">
<title></title>
<link rel="stylesheet" href="../css/bootstrap.min.css" />
</head>
<body>
AngularJS HTML DOM
AngularJS为HTML DOM 元素的属性提供了绑定应用数据的指令。
ng-disabled指令
ng-disabled指令直接绑定应用数据到HTML的disabled属性。
实例:
<button ng-disableled="mySwitch">点我!</button
领取专属 10元无门槛券
手把手带您无忧上云